Recap: Bishop Blanchet Bears vs. Ballard Beavers

Even though The Ballard Beavers scored an imposing 53 points on Friday, the Bishop Blanchet Bears still came out on top. In a tight match that could have gone either way, Bishop Blanchet made off with a 54-53 win over Ballard. The victory made it back-to-back wins for Bishop Blanchet.

Despite the loss, Ballard still got an impressive performance from Joe Farley, who threw for 278 yards and six touchdowns. Farley is on a roll when it comes to passing touchdowns, as he's now passed for three or more in the last three games he's played. Another player making a difference was Adam Tripp, who picked up 74 receiving yards and three touchdowns.

Bishop Blanchet's win was their third straight at home, bumping their overall record up to 4-4. Admittedly, the team didn't face the toughest opposition across those games, namely Ballard, Lincoln, and Seattle Prep. As for Ballard, they are on a five-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 2-6.

Bishop Blanchet does not have any more games scheduled as of now. Ballard will be playing in front of their home fans against Lincoln at 1:00 p.m. on Saturday. Lincoln is still on the hunt for that elusive first 'W'.
